I ask unanimous consent that the Committee on Veterans' Affairs be discharged from further consideration of S. 946 and the Senate proceed to its immediate consideration. The PRESIDING OFFICER. Without objection, it is so ordered. The clerk will report the bill by title. The senior assistant legislative clerk read as follows: A bill (S. 946) to require the Secretary of Veterans Affairs to hire additional Veterans Justice Outreach Specialists to provide treatment court services to justice- involved veterans, and for other purposes. There being no objection, the Senate proceeded to consider the bill.
